Specifically for Turbine (power & aerospace) component heat treatment & brazing requirement, ALD Dynatech has prepared itself with the following features and facilities:

 
ALD Dynatech is fully qualified and experienced with Graphite Hot Zone Insulation & Heater design, manufacture and assembly – understanding the unique strengths of this insulation and heater system. ALD Dynatech has pioneered the “Fit & Forget” Graphite Hot Zone design that has stood the reliability with time
ALD Dynatech designs furnaces for use upto 2,400 F (1,320 C)
Entire Hot Zone of ALD Dynatech vacuum furnace is faced with CFC panels which enables minimal, if not, zero maintenance of it’s hot zones, as a standard feature
ALD Dynatech vacuum furnace vessels are designed and manufactured as per ASME Sec VIII Div 1 U Code Stamped
ALD Dynatech provides double walled carbon steel and stainless steel vessels
ALD Dynatech vacuum furnace are equipped with internal heat exchanger and quench fan with motor
ALD Dynatech is fully geared to come up to the demanding leak tightness requirements of the vacuum furnaces for auto-component brazing requirement – it has demonstrated vacuum leak rates of upto 1 micron/ Hour
ALD Dynatech is familiar and has designed vacuum furnaces that meet or exceed specifications like GM DC-9999-1, Ford AMTD-2710, NADCA, AMS2769A, AMS 2759/7 A etc.
ALD Dynatech vacuum furnaces comply with AMS 2750 Pyrometry
ALD Dynatech has sufficient experience and expertise in design, manufacture and maintenance of high Vacuum requirements of the auto-component brazing needs (order of 10-5 torr or better)
ALD Dynatech vacuum furnaces provide unique features and facilities specially aimed at meeting or exceeding auto-component specific requirements like distortion etc.
ALD Dynatech vacuum furnaces provide Isothermal Quench facility with unique mar quench features
ALD Dynatech vacuum heat treat furnaces provide inert gas pressure quench facility upto 10-bar (a), as a standard feature
ALD Dynatech vacuum furnaces provide partial pressure facility, as a standard feature
ALD Dynatech`s unique quench gas flow adjustability and flexibility (with only pneumatic movements) enables customers to adjust quench gas flow patterns to suit loading density and component geometry
ALD Dynatech`s unique electrical feedthrough design ensures that the feedthorughs do not allow high current arcing at the feedthorughs and thus provide a long lasting feedthrough connection
ALD Dynatech “Fit & Forget” Graphite Hot Zone also provides the lowest steady state heat loss figures of under 5 watts/ sq. inch at 2,200 F (1,200 C) operating temperature and lower values at lower temperatures
All ALD Dynatech vacuum furnaces are provided with PC based SCADA Control System and or with Touch Screen Control System with Remote Access and Trouble Shoot facility
